Technical Field
The invention relates to the field of medical treatment, in particular to brain operation auxiliary equipment for neurosurgery clinic.
Background
Brain surgery generally refers to neurosurgery, and is a subject of comprehensive treatment and comprehensive evaluation by mainly examination and operation. The youngest, most complex and most rapidly developing discipline in medicine. Previously, due to technical limitations, human brain surgery has been a forbidden area, however, with the development of technology, various types of microneurosurgery have been performed with the aid of advanced microsurgical equipment.
Present brain operating table is fixed the setting mostly in the operating room, can not change patient's head position, is unfavorable for the main sword doctor to operate, moreover, does not set up utensil place the platform in the current operating table, and the surgical equipment that the doctor needs need is got through the nurse transmission and is taken, and is very inconvenient.

Referring to fig. 1 to 3, in the embodiment of the present invention, an neurosurgical brain surgery auxiliary device for clinical use includes a base 1, a support member 2 is fixedly installed on the base 1 through a bolt, a bed plate 3 for a patient to lie is hinged to the top of the support member 2, and a driving mechanism for adjusting an inclination angle of the bed plate 3 is arranged between the bed plate 3 and the support member 2;
a supporting plate 15 used for placing surgical instruments is movably arranged on the side wall of the bed plate 3, the supporting plate 15 is connected with the bed plate 3 through a power mechanism, a layer of sponge cushion 17 is laid on the bed plate 3, and one end of the sponge cushion 17 is provided with a headrest 18 for a patient to rest his head;
the driving mechanism drives the bed plate 3 to turn over relative to the top of the supporting piece 2, so that the lying angle of the patient is adjusted; the height of the supporting plate 15 is adjusted by the aid of the power mechanism, so that a doctor can conveniently take the surgical tool.
In one embodiment of the present invention, the driving mechanism comprises a cylinder 4 fixedly mounted on the support 2, a piston rod 5 sealingly slidably disposed on the upper portion of the cylinder 4, and a sliding assembly for connecting the piston rod 5 and the side wall of the bed plate 3;
the piston rod 5 is driven to stretch along the vertical direction through the cylinder 4, so that the sliding assembly is driven to drive the bed plate 3 to wind the top of the support piece 2 to overturn, and the pitch angle of a patient is adjusted, so that the operation can be conveniently carried out.
In another embodiment of the present invention, the sliding assembly includes a convex pillar 7 fixed on the top of the piston rod 5 and a guide slot 6 opened along the side wall of the bed plate 3 and slidably engaged with the convex pillar 7;
when the piston rod 5 stretches, the convex column 7 is driven to vertically lift, so that the guide groove 6 is driven to drive the bed plate 3 to turn around the top of the support piece 2.
In another embodiment of the present invention, the power mechanism includes a screw 8 rotatably disposed on the sidewall of the bed plate 3, a screw sleeve 10 threadedly connected to the screw 8, and a rod set for connecting the supporting plate 15 and the screw sleeve 10;
a rotating wheel 9 for driving the screw 8 to rotate is fixed at the end part of the screw 8, and the supporting plate 15 is arranged on the lifting piece 13;
the rotating wheel 9 is rotated to drive the screw rod 8 to rotate, so that the threaded sleeve 10 is driven to run along the axis direction of the screw rod 8, the lifting piece 13 and the supporting plate 15 are driven by the driving rod set to be parallel to the lifting of the bed plate 1, and the function of height adjustment is achieved.
In another embodiment of the present invention, the rod set comprises two swing rods 12 for connecting the bed plate 3 and the lifting member 13, one end of each swing rod 12 is hinged on the lifting member 13, the other end of each swing rod 12 is hinged on the bed plate 3, the two swing rods 12 are parallel to each other, and the screw sleeve 10 is connected with one of the swing rods 12 through a connecting rod 11;
one end of the connecting rod 11 is hinged on the threaded sleeve 10, and the other end of the connecting rod is hinged on the swing rod 12;
when the screw sleeve 10 runs along the axis of the screw 8, one of the swing rods 12 is driven to swing by the connecting rod 11, and as a parallelogram is formed between the two swing rods 12 and the lifting piece 13 and the bed plate 3, the lifting piece 13 can be driven to swing and lift in parallel with the bed plate 3.
In another embodiment of the present invention, a rotating member 14 is disposed on the lifting member 13, a rotating shaft is disposed on the rotating member 14, the rotating shaft is fixedly connected to the supporting plate 15, and a damping sleeve is disposed between the rotating shaft and the rotating member 14;
through the arrangement of the damping sleeve, friction damping is arranged between the rotating shaft and the rotating part 14, so that the angle of the supporting plate 15 can be adjusted conveniently, and when the bed plate 3 is inclined, the angle of the supporting plate 15 can be adjusted to be always in a horizontal position.
In another embodiment of the present invention, the rotating member 14 is rotatably disposed on the lifting member 13, and a stop member 16 cooperating with the rotating member 14 is fixed on the outer side of the lifting member 13;
the rotating part 14 arranged by rotation enables the supporting plate 15 and the lifting part 13 to rotate relatively, when a patient needs to get up from the bed plate 3, the supporting plate 15 can be turned over by 90 degrees, so that the supporting plate 15 is in a vertical state and cannot be blocked; and the stop piece 16 can limit the rotation angle of the rotating piece 14 and the supporting plate 15 relative to the lifting piece 13, and the supporting plate 15 can be kept stable in the horizontal position.
